High Schmidt Mass Transfer Using Chapman-Khun’S Near Wall Coherent Structure Model, Mingyong Chen, Qian Chen, Jiang Zhe, Vijay Modi Apr 2015

High Schmidt number mass transfer in a fully developed turbulent flow is examined using a near wall coherent structure model. The computational approach relies on specification of idealized boundary conditions in the form of a two eddy structure imposed at a distance of y+=40 away from the wall. The parameters describing the spatial and temporal eddy behavior are obtained from a combination of experimental observation, analysis and computer trials as described by D.R. Chapman, G.D.
